如何在quickblox for android中获取好友请求信息

时间:2014-11-03 12:51:02

标签: quickblox

我想在quickblox for android中知道当前的朋友请求状态(如果已接受或仍然未决)。有没有办法在quikblox中存储朋友请求信息,还是应该维护我自己的远程数据库?

1 个答案:

答案 0 :(得分:2)

在Sing into聊天的onSuccess中使用此代码

QBRoster chatRosteR=QBChatService.getInstance().getRoster(QBRoster.SubscriptionMode.mutual, subscriptionListener);

并使用此侦听器。

QBSubscriptionListener subscriptionListener = new QBSubscriptionListener() {
    @Override
    public void subscriptionRequested(final int userId) {
        Log.e("friend request", userId + "");
        //friend id
    }
};

希望这会对你有所帮助